Abstract

Purpose

The purpose of this study is to investigate how Toyota Kata can be effectively applied in the engineer-to-order (ETO) manufacturing within the construction industry. The objective is to identify the critical success factors (CSFs) for the Toyota Kata implementation in this environment and to develop a continuous improvement (CI) method – based on Toyota Kata and adapted to the ETO manufacturing within the construction industry.

Design/methodology/approach

An action research (AR) approach was applied, which includes a participatory form of inquiry and learning from both intended and unintended outcomes, while simultaneously building up scientific knowledge about successful implementation of Toyota Kata.

Findings

All the CSFs in the AR project are addressed by the earlier literature, thus confirming the existing body of knowledge. Moreover, the existing knowledge was arguably extended through the modified Toyota Kata as an approach for CI. New elements regarding how to run the small experiments by extending the core team with personnel who work with the problem on a daily basis.

Originality/value

This research addresses a gap identified in the literature regarding how Toyota Kata can be adapted to the ETO manufacturing within the construction industry. It also presents an overview of CSFs for the Toyota Kata implementation in this environment.

Abstract

Purpose

Upcoming as well as mature industries are facing pressure as regards successfully managing operational excellence, and, at the same time, driving and managing innovation. Quality management concepts and practices’ ability to tackle this challenge have been questioned. It has even been suggested that there is a need to provide and promote an updated/changed, and even re-branded, version of Total Quality Management, merging quality management (QM) and innovation management (IM). Can such a shift then actually be spotted? The purpose of this paper is to explore and see if there are any signs suggesting that QM and IM actually are about to merge.

Design/methodology/approach

The study is based on literature reviews, document studies and interviews.

Findings

The paper highlights three signs indicating that QM and IM indeed are approaching each other, and that it is a movement driven from both sectors, e.g., in the work with new ISO-standards and the Toyota Kata framework.

Originality/value

The indicated development has fundamental and extensive practical implications. It will for example have to be followed by a similar merging of the two fields in the educational system, and in the competences of future managers.

Abstract

Purpose

Investigating the beginning of project management (app. 30 BC) with a focus on business models similar to the “PDCA” cycle, the purpose of this paper is to find an approach which could be used as a new standard procedure for the eradication of projects in Lean project management.

Design/methodology/approach

Based on literature research of models similar to Walter A. Shehwart’s three-step and Edward W. Deming’s four-step (PDC(A)) wheel, the investigated models are interconnected to form a new concept which represents an innovative cycle logic proposed to be applied in Lean project management. This new cycle logic is rolled out on three different levels, which are transferred from the Lean management hoshin kanri model to Lean project management. In addition to literature research, semi-structured interviews were performed to get an indication as to the integration of Lean management (with a focus on PDCA) in project management today.

Findings

It was found that the “Check Plan Do” cycle is a Lean variant of the “Plan Do Check Act” model that is already used in consulting projects in practice, partially appears in project management standards, in governance models of ambulance, fire services, human aid and military forces and in quality management models of Six Sigma, design for Six Sigma and an excellence model of the European Foundation for Quality Management. To ensure continuous improvement it was found that the new CPD cycle can be used on different “planning” levels in analogy to the hoshin kanri logic.

Originality/value

To the best of the author’s knowledge, a discussion as to how the PDCA cycle can be adapted to Lean project management, considering the implication of business models similar to the PDCA wheel, has not yet been conducted within the field of project management.

Abstract

Purpose

This paper aims to resolve the inhibitors of lean service using knowledge management (KM) concepts through the use of Toyota Kata. To achieve this, the authors updated the research on lean supportive practices and inhibitors of lean technical practices presented by Hadid and Afshin Mansouri (2014) through a systematic literature review (SLR). The SLR focused on empirical studies/cases from the past 15 years and confirmed the inhibitors of lean technical practices. As a result, Toyota Kata is proposed as a KM solution to the inhibitors of lean service implementation in service companies.

Design/methodology/approach

The authors carried out an SLR to identify inhibitors of lean service in real case applications and analyzed the resulting bibliographic portfolio using KM as a lens, along with three theories: universal theory, socio-technical systems theory and contingency theory, which assist in highlighting and clarifying the potential impact of using Toyota Kata as a solution to the inhibitors of lean technical practices.

Findings

When the authors analyzed the inhibitors of lean technical practices, they discovered that there is a strong relationship between the inhibitors and the individual (staff) personal characteristics regarding commitment, involvement, communication and preparation. These inhibitors and characteristics should work as a system, and Toyota Kata improves people’s skills and process performance by connecting people, processes and technology. Also, the authors noted that the Toyota Kata concept used can provide benefits in the implementation of lean service for companies, such as the internalization of continuous improvement, this becoming part of the company culture. Moreover, it has been demonstrated that Toyota Kata provides an effective way to achieve KM.

Research limitations/implications

This study may not have enabled a complete coverage of all existing peer-reviewed articles in the field of practices and inhibitors presented by Hadid and Afshin Mansouri (2014). However, it seems reasonable to assume that in this review, a large proportion of the studies available was included.

Practical implications

This paper opens a new perspective on the use of Toyota Kata by managers as a solution to implement KM, spinning the spiral of knowledge.

Originality/value

This is the first study that seeks empirical evidence of inhibitors of lean technical practices and proposes Toyota Kata as a KM Solution for these issues. As a result, this study advances the facility to overcome these inhibitors, opening a new perspective for management to lead in achieving operational excellence.

Abstract

Purpose

The purpose of this paper is to explore, study, analyze and implement Kaizen–Kata methodology in a service food organization (first-level restaurant), facing challenges in different operational processes that affect and influence the case company performance and customer satisfaction.

Design/methodology/approach

The service organization implemented Kaizen–Kata methodology to improve one operational problem process. A case-study approach was used in this research to understand the effects of the Kaizen–Kata methodology in solving problems in their operational service process. Different Kaizen–Kata techniques and tools (histograms, Pareto chart and Ishikawa diagram) using the Plan, Do, Check, Act improvement cycle framework were used.

Findings

Successful implementation of the proposed methodology reduced the main impact of the problem’s effects (customer’s complaints, process reworking, extra-cost, delays, among others). The effects of the problem were reduced on average by 70%. Some Kaizen–Kata routines were identified in a service process environment.

Research limitations/implications

The main limitation of the research is that this work is a just one-case study. A main generalization is not possible, because it involves a company within a company.

Practical implications

Some other service companies can use the Kaizen–Kata methodology to solve any kind of operational problem within their processes. Service managers can learn about the methodology to apply and improve their operational performance and handle customer’s complaints.

Originality/value

A continuous improvement manufacturing methodology was imported to apply in an operational service process. The Kaizen–Kata methodology contributed significantly to reduce delays, handle customer’s complaints, process reworking and deal with extra costs, among other operational problems’ effects. In addition to that, in the literature, most of the Kaizen applications are in manufacturing companies. To the best of authors’ knowledge, this was the first study of applied Kaizen–Kata in a service organization (a fast-food restaurant).

Abstract

Purpose

Building on the routine dynamics literature, this paper aims to expand our philosophical, practical and infrastructural understanding of implementing lean production. The authors provide a process view on the interplay between lean operating routines and continuous improvement (CI) routines and the roles of different actors in initiating and establishing these routines.

Design/methodology/approach

Using data from interviews, observations and document analysis, retrospective comparative analyses of three embedded case studies on lean implementations provide a process understanding of enacting and patterning lean operating and CI routines in manufacturing SMEs.

Findings

Incorporating the “who” and “how” next to the “what” of practices and routines helps explain that rather than being implemented in isolation or even in conjunction with each other, sustainable lean practices and routines come about through team leader and employee enactment of the CI practices and routines. Neglecting these patterns aligned with unsustainable implementations.

Research limitations/implications

The proposed process model provides a valuable way to integrate variance and process streams of literature to better understand lean production implementations.

Practical implications

The process model helps manufacturing managers, policy makers, consultants and educators to reconsider their approach to implementing lean production or teaching how to do so.

Originality/value

Nuancing the existing lean implementation literature, the proposed process model shows that CI routines do not stem from implementing lean operating routines. Rather, the model highlights the importance of active engagement of actors at multiple organizational levels and strong connections between and across levels to change routines and work practices for implementing lean production.

Abstract

Purpose

This study empirically tests a model of human capital (HC) factors affecting the organisational competitiveness (OC) of automotive parts suppliers in the Industry 4.0 framework, including concepts such as Toyota Kata (TK), Kaizen and Quality 4.0, during the coronavirus disease 2019 pandemic.

Design/methodology/approach

An instrument was created to measure emotional intelligence (EI) and analytical skill (AS) as input variables and OC as the output variable. The instrument was distributed electronically to Tier 1 non-technical employees in Nuevo León and Querétaro, México. A total of 195 surveys were obtained. The instrument used stepwise multiple linear regression.

Findings

This study proposes a model to strengthen the OC of Tier 1 automotive parts supply industry from the perspective of HC factors. Furthermore, it is shown that EI and AS have a positive and significant impact on OC.

Practical implications

From an HC perspective, this study provides a useful basis to improve OC for researchers, industry experts and managers at different levels of the automotive industry, including the triple helix (academia, industry and the government).

Originality/value

No studies simultaneously test the relationship of EI and AS to OC; therefore, this study fills a gap in the literature. Furthermore, the study explored the literature on individual Kaizen (IK) and TK, leading to a contrast between the definitions of EI and AS. Finally, for EI, a reference to motivation was found in the IK. In the case of AS, an orientation to ability of problem solving was found in TK.

Abstract

Purpose

The purpose of this paper is to reach a deeper understanding of the Lean principle of respect for people (RFP to facilitate Lean implementation in Western organizations outside Toyota.

Design/methodology/approach

This study uses an interpretative, hermeneutic approach to understand the RFP concept through a literature study of existing research about Lean implementation, and an inquiry into the underlying meaning of the RFP principle, by studying sources from Toyota and discussions about the RFP principle in Japan.

Findings

RFP is seen as a central principle in Lean implementations, but the failure of RFP is believed to cause Lean implementations to fail. The literature about Lean discusses the RFP principle both as a general positive atmosphere and as focused on developing the work capacity of employees. By studying the sources from Toyota, it could be understood that RFP is based on ought-respect. The authors also find that RFP is related to takumi, a perfected form of craftsmanship. The authors translate the concept to English by tying it to the recent literature about craft to develop RFP as RFC – respect for craftsmanship.

Research limitations/implications

As this is a conceptual paper, it is difficult to translate the findings into a tool for companies and organizations to use. However, that is the point of the paper: that the most important ideas are not translatable into tools.

Practical implications

It is necessary in Lean implementations to connect people’s work to craftsmanship. Through a discussion of craftsmanship before Lean implementations, it might be possible to nurture an understanding of the underlying values of Lean.

Originality/value

The authors have not found any papers that propose takumi as the base of the RFP principle, nor as a foundational concept at Toyota. It is necessary to understand the concept of takumi, as perfection in craft, to understand the RFP principle.

Abstract

Purpose

The purpose of this paper is to address the organizational implications of transformative Lean Deployment initiatives, leveraging the Viable System Model to understand what is needed organizationally so these initiatives can succeed and take root.

Design/methodology/approach

The paper starts by pointing out how Lean practices presuppose and demand empowered, autonomous organizational units at all levels. It then highlights how Lean manages the resulting Recursive Organization of “autonomous units within autonomous units” through powerful cohesion mechanisms addressing the negotiation of goals and resources, unit-to-unit coordination and process monitoring – with tools such as Pull, Kanban, Hoshin Kanri, A3 and the Toyota Kata, supported by operational practices such as Visual Controls, Standard Work, etc.

Findings

The Viable System Model was found to provide a valuable guide for articulating the organizational underpinnings of Lean deployments, including the effective, recursive distribution of deployment responsibility and authority at all levels, the identification of the right composition and reporting structure of implementation teams, and the role to be attributed to support organizations.

Originality/value

The approach provides a framework for understanding the organizational implications and possible resistance to comprehensive Lean deployments, and for appropriately including the all-important organizational dimension in order to promote the success of these deployments. It is also hoped that the paper can contribute to a more holistic, integrative understanding of what it means for an organization to embark on its Lean journey.
